International Personal Data Protection and Digital Identity Management Tools

3 Pages Posted: 28 Jun 2006

Abstract

International guidelines establish principles for the treatment of personal data. Might digital identity management tools simultaneously allow the interests of government, the private sector, and the citizen to be met - namely, legitimate government access to and sharing of personal data, efficiency in web-services exchanges, and effective protections for personal data?
